GRAHAM — Teenagers carrying realistic-looking Airsoft rifles caused a scare Friday afternoon at a Graham elementary school.
Pierce County sheriff’s deputies responding to a 911 call from a teacher detained nine youths and recovered at last seven of the pellet rifles.
No one was injured.
It wasn’t immediately clear what the young people were doing.
The sheriff’s department said it received numerous calls about armed teens on the grounds of Graham Elementary School about 4 p.m.
Classes were over for the day but a few teachers and students were still on campus for after-school programs.
The sheriff’s office said the teens were being booked for investigation of possessing dangerous weapons on school grounds.
